@opena2a/registry-client
HTTP client for the OpenA2A Registry trust query endpoints. Shared implementation used by hackmyagent, opena2a-cli, and ai-trust so all three CLIs produce identical trust output on the same input.
Install
npm install @opena2a/registry-clientConsumers pin exact versions (no caret) per the OpenA2A supply-chain policy. Use "@opena2a/registry-client": "0.2.0" in dependencies.
This package is ESM-only ("type": "module"). Consumers must use ESM ("type": "module" in their package.json, or .mjs/.mts files).

First-party provenance signing
To self-tag a privileged provenance class (first_party_scanner | ci | partner), pass a
FirstPartySigner as the second argument to publishScan. The signer stamps
source/nonce/signedAt/signature/publicKey over the registry's strong canonical
(name|version|score|maxScore|source|nonce|signedAt). The registry honors the claimed
source only when the signing key is on its FIRST_PARTY_SCANNER_PUBKEYS allowlist and
the signature, single-use nonce, and freshness window all check out — otherwise it fails
closed and records the scan as community (no error).

console.log(direct.publicKey); // base64 — register this in FIRST_PARTY_SCANNER_PUBKEYSsignedAt is stamped in Unix seconds; each sign() mints a fresh single-use nonce. The
tweetnacl signature is byte-compatible with the registry's Go crypto/ed25519 verifier.
Design constraints
- The client never computes a trust level.
trustLevelcomes from the server. If the server returns no level, the CLI renders a "Listed — not yet assessed" path. - Opinionated defaults, minimal knobs. 10 s per-request timeout, 60 s read-method cache TTL, both tunable via
RegistryClientOptions. - Structured errors.
PackageNotFoundErroron 404;RegistryApiErrorwith acode(not_found | unauthorized | forbidden | rate_limited | bad_request | server_error | network | timeout | invalid_response) and optionalstatusCode+bodyfor everything else. CLIs render prose from these codes. - No telemetry side effects. The client sends the
User-Agentthe caller provides; it does not log or emit anything.
